Day 2 Boyne Valley & Cooley Peninsula (Sunday)

Leaving Dublin, we head north thru’ the rich pasturelands of the Boyne valley and visit the site of the famous Battle of the Boyne near Drogheda where in 1690 King William defeated his fatherin- law King James. Both Kings commanded their armies in person with over 60,000 troops deployed - the largest number ever on an Irish battlefield. Afterwards we continue around the Cooley Peninsula, see ‘the Mountains sweep down to the sea’ and arrive in Belfast late afternoon. (B, D)

Day 6 Connemara (Thursday)

Connemara remains the wildest and the most romantic place in Ireland. A drive around Murrisk Peninsula brings us to Killary Harbour Ireland’s only true fjord. Enjoy a photo stop at Kylemore Abbey on the shores of Kylemore Lough before circling Connemara and crossing Maam Valley where blackheaded sheep make up a large part of the population. Back in Westport you will have time to explore this town which was voted Ireland’s tidiest in 2008. (B, D)
